1:39Now PlayingA fuel shortage in Cuba brought about by a U.S. oil blockade on the island has created a new crisis: garbage. Ed Augustin reports that trash has been piling up on streets as trucks are missing parts for repair and fuel to run, which is also raising the risk of mosquito-borne diseases spreading across the country.
